Primeiro pedido de ajuda - Insert

Delphi

03/12/2003

Oi Pessoal,

Essa eh uma dúvida que me ronda a cabeça a tempos, queria saber como faço para fazer um INSERT no banco de dados, sem usar aquela barrinha dbNavigator, tipo, quero fazer um insert colocando os campos e ao clicar num bitButton ele faça o insert no banco.

Não sei se consegui ser claro, mas por favor me ajudem

Abraços,


E.nunes

E.nunes

Curtidas 0

Respostas

Martoss

Martoss

03/12/2003

voce cria dentro da procedure do envento onClick do bit btn com o seguinte codigo.

var sql:string;
begin
SQL:=´ INSERT INTO NomeDaTabela SET NomeCampo1,NomeCampo2. ´;
SQL:=SQL + ´ Values (´ ´´´ + edtNome.text + ´´´,´´´ + edtEndereco.text + ´´´ ´)´;
Obs. A seguencia dos campos no value deve ser a mesa dos campos na tabela onde vai inserir.
adoQuery.active:=false;
adoQuery.sql.clear;
adoQuery.sql.add(SQL);
adoQuery.active:=true;

Primeiro voce monta a string SQL com os dados que quer gravar na tabela, vc insere na tabela uma adoQuery e depois dispara com os comandos acima para executar a gravação.

Se tiver duvidas meail-me


GOSTEI 0
Carlosk

Carlosk

03/12/2003

insert into TABELA (CAMPO1, CAMPO2) values (´STRING´,INTEGER)

saco?

abracos


GOSTEI 0
E.nunes

E.nunes

03/12/2003

Valeu mesmo...
O Insert eu jah sabia, mas naum sabia os procedimentos todos

Isso eu naum encontrei em livro...

Abraços,


GOSTEI 0
POSTAR